Question - Why putting a coating on above a PPF? And...how do you properly maintain a PPF and/or Ceramic? I.E. - will you ever use wax? Yearly machine detail?
Interested in the thoughts....thanks!
ceramic coating on top of the ppf is the usual way versus the other way around. it will be the initial protection and provide ease of cleaning due to its hydrophobic properties
